Incomplete intertrochanteric fractures: imaging features and clinical management.

E Schultz1, T T Miller, S D Boruchov

  • 1Department of Radiology, North Shore University Hospital, Manhasset, NY 11030, USA.

Radiology
|April 6, 1999
PubMed
Summary

Magnetic resonance (MR) imaging unequivocally diagnoses incomplete intertrochanteric fractures, a subset often missed by radiography. Surgical intervention may lead to faster ambulation but similar functional outcomes compared to conservative treatment.

Area of Science:

  • Orthopedic surgery
  • Radiology
  • Medical imaging

Background:

  • Incomplete intertrochanteric fractures represent a distinct injury pattern.
  • Accurate diagnosis is crucial for appropriate management and patient outcomes.

Purpose of the Study:

  • To detail the imaging characteristics of incomplete intertrochanteric fractures using magnetic resonance (MR) imaging.
  • To compare MR findings with conventional radiography.
  • To review treatment strategies and outcomes for this fracture type.

Main Methods:

  • Retrospective review of 31 patients diagnosed with incomplete intertrochanteric fractures via MR imaging.
  • Comparison of MR findings with radiographic data in 30 patients.
  • Analysis of fracture characteristics, treatment modalities (surgical vs. conservative), and functional follow-up.

Main Results:

  • Radiographic and MR findings showed poor correlation; radiography missed most incomplete intertrochanteric fractures.
  • Fracture characteristics (length, involvement of greater trochanter, midline crossing in axial plane) were similar between surgical and conservative groups.
  • Fractures crossing the coronal midline were more frequent in the surgically treated group (50% vs. 23%).
  • Surgical treatment resulted in a 2-day shorter time to ambulation, with no significant difference in subjective functional status at follow-up.

Conclusions:

  • Incomplete intertrochanteric fractures are a unique subset of intertrochanteric fractures.
  • MR imaging is essential for unequivocal diagnosis of these fractures.
  • While surgery may expedite ambulation, functional outcomes appear comparable to conservative management in the short term.
